El-Rufai alleged corruption: Kaduna Assembly Seeks Probes

The Kaduna State House Assembly Committee has recommended a thorough investigation and prosecution of Governor Nasir El-Rufai over allegations of corruption and misappropriation of funds.

The committee made the recommendation after a thorough investigation into El-Rufai alleged corruption and financial mismanagement.

The committee found that Governor El-Rufai was involved in several cases of corruption and misappropriation of funds during his tenure as Governor of Kaduna State.

The committee identified several instances of irregular financial transactions, including the withdrawal of large sums of money without proper authorization, and the award of contracts without due process.

The committee also found that the Governor had breached his oath of office and had failed to exercise due discretion in the administration of the state.

The committee recommended that the Governor be referred to the relevant law enforcement agencies for investigation and prosecution.

The committee’s findings and recommendations are contained in a report dated May 29, 2023, which was presented to the Kaduna State House Assembly yesterday.

The report is based on evidence gathered from various sources, including bank statements, financial records, and testimony from witnesses.

 

Some of the key findings and recommendations of the committee include:

  • The withdrawal of N4,936,916,333.00 by the Commissioner of Finance and the Accountant General of the State between 2019 and 2022 without proper authorization.

  • The payment of $1.4 million USD from the Kaduna State Economic Transformation Account without proper authorization.

  • The award of contracts to companies without due process, resulting in the abandonment of several projects.

  • The diversion of funds meant for execution of projects, resulting in financial losses to the state.

  • The breach of the oath of office by the Governor and failure to exercise due discretion in the administration of the state.

The committee recommended that all parties involved in these irregularities be investigated and prosecuted accordingly.

The committee also recommended that all contracts awarded without due process be reviewed and those found to be irregular be cancelled.

The report is expected to be tabled before the Kaduna State House Assembly soon, where it will be debated and voted on.

If approved, the report will be forwarded to the relevant law enforcement agencies for investigation and prosecution.

It is not yet clear whether Governor El-Rufai will respond to the allegations made against him.
